[PATCH] cfg80211: improve warnings in VHT rate calculation

Linus reported hitting the bandwidth warning, but it is indeed
pretty useless - improve it by printing the rate configuration
and make it only warn once, for both warnings here.

diff --git a/net/wireless/util.c b/net/wireless/util.c
index 7198373e2920..a10d5c7bdf63 100644
--- a/net/wireless/util.c
+++ b/net/wireless/util.c
@@ -1217,8 +1217,8 @@ static u32 cfg80211_calculate_bitrate_vht(struct rate_info *rate)
 	u32 bitrate;
 	int idx;
 
-	if (WARN_ON_ONCE(rate->mcs > 9))
-		return 0;
+	if (rate->mcs > 9)
+		goto warn;
 
 	switch (rate->bw) {
 	case RATE_INFO_BW_160:
@@ -1233,8 +1233,7 @@ static u32 cfg80211_calculate_bitrate_vht(struct rate_info *rate)
 	case RATE_INFO_BW_5:
 	case RATE_INFO_BW_10:
 	default:
-		WARN_ON(1);
-		/* fall through */
+		goto warn;
 	case RATE_INFO_BW_20:
 		idx = 0;
 	}
@@ -1247,6 +1246,10 @@ static u32 cfg80211_calculate_bitrate_vht(struct rate_info *rate)
 
 	/* do NOT round down here */
 	return (bitrate + 50000) / 100000;
+ warn:
+	WARN_ONCE(1, "invalid rate bw=%d, mcs=%d, nss=%d\n",
+		  rate->bw, rate->mcs, rate->nss);
+	return 0;
 }
